Looking for the best Christmas recipes in Porto? In Porto and the north, the Christmas holidays are dedicated to our families and friends. And though this year there will be fewer family members at the table and less freedom of movement on the street, we can all agree that this can be an excellent time to shake up your dinner routine.

Here, it all starts on Christmas Eve with a ‘Consoada‘ aka Christmas Dinner, where all the family gathers around a carefully dressed Christmas table and enjoys an easily three to four-hour dining experience.

What do we put on our Christmas dinner tables?

1. Bacalhau (codfish)

Our Christmas is not imaginable without eating at least one dish with codfish, aka bacalhau, and all the trimmings: potatoes, carrots, radishes, carrots, kale and eggs. Simply boiled is the main method of preparation, but always generously sprinkled with extra virgin olive oil. 2. Desserts

Like we cannot imagine Christmas without Bacalhau, we also cannot imagine it without various desserts served during the holiday season. Here are some of the most typical Christmas deserts and how to prepare them at home.

  • Aletria recipe (a favorite for kids of all ages, from 0 to 99);
  • Rabanadas recipe (gather your close family for an assembly line approach and you will be truly embracing the Portuguese way);
  • Pão de Ló recipe (it has been around in Portuguese cuisine since at least 1700. Can you believe it?);
  • Formigos de Natal recipe (this dessert combines the spirit of Porto with the traditions of Trás-os-Montes).
